MySQL是一个开源的关系型数据库管理系统,它使用标准的SQL语言进行数据操作,在Windows环境下,我们可以通过命令行工具cmd来操控MySQL数据库,本文将详细介绍如何使用cmd来连接MySQL数据库,执行SQL语句,以及管理数据库。
安装MySQL
我们需要在Windows环境下安装MySQL,可以从MySQL官网下载对应的安装包,按照提示进行安装,安装完成后,会在系统环境变量中添加MySQL的路径。
启动MySQL服务
安装完成后,我们需要启动MySQL服务,可以通过以下两种方式启动:
1、通过“开始”菜单启动:点击“开始”菜单,找到“MySQL”文件夹,点击“MySQL Server 5.7”,即可启动MySQL服务。
2、通过cmd启动:打开cmd,输入以下命令:
net start mysql
连接MySQL数据库
启动MySQL服务后,我们可以通过cmd来连接MySQL数据库,连接数据库需要提供用户名、密码和数据库名,以下是连接数据库的命令:
mysql -u 用户名 -p 密码 -D 数据库名
我们要连接名为test的数据库,用户名为root,密码为123456,可以输入以下命令:
mysql -u root -p123456 -D test
输入命令后,会提示输入密码,输入正确的密码后,即可成功连接到数据库。
执行SQL语句
连接成功后,我们可以在cmd中执行SQL语句,以下是一些常用的SQL语句:
1、创建数据库:
CREATE DATABASE 数据库名;
2、删除数据库:
DROP DATABASE 数据库名;
3、创建表:
CREATE TABLE 表名 (列名1 数据类型, 列名2 数据类型, ...);
4、删除表:
DROP TABLE 表名;
5、插入数据:
INSERT INTO 表名 (列名1, 列名2, ...) VALUES (值1, 值2, ...);
6、查询数据:
SELECT 列名1, 列名2, ... FROM 表名;
7、更新数据:
UPDATE 表名 SET 列名1=值1, 列名2=值2, ... WHERE 条件;
8、删除数据:
DELETE FROM 表名 WHERE 条件;
管理数据库
除了执行SQL语句外,我们还可以通过cmd来管理MySQL数据库,以下是一些常用的管理命令:
1、查看所有数据库:
SHOW DATABASES;
2、选择数据库:
USE 数据库名;
3、查看当前数据库的所有表:
SHOW TABLES;
4、查看表结构:
DESCRIBE 表名;
5、修改表结构:
ALTER TABLE 表名 ADD/DROP/MODIFY COLUMN 列名 数据类型;
相关问题与解答栏目:Q&A: Q1: 如果忘记了MySQL的密码,如何重置? A1: 如果忘记了MySQL的密码,可以通过以下步骤重置:1.停止MySQL服务;2.在命令行中进入MySQL的bin目录;3.运行mysqld --skip-grant-tables;4.启动MySQL服务;5.登录MySQL,修改密码。 Q2: 如果需要在cmd中执行多个SQL语句,如何操作? A2: 如果需要在cmd中执行多个SQL语句,可以将多个SQL语句用分号隔开,然后一起执行。CREATE DATABASE test; SHOW DATABASES;
。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/394143.html